网络软件监控如何识别网络攻击?
在当今信息时代,网络安全问题日益突出,网络攻击手段也不断翻新。为了保障网络安全,网络软件监控成为企业、组织和个人不可或缺的安全防护手段。本文将探讨网络软件监控如何识别网络攻击,帮助读者了解网络安全防护的重要性。
一、网络软件监控概述
网络软件监控是指通过技术手段,实时监测网络中的数据流量、系统状态、用户行为等信息,以便及时发现并防范网络攻击。网络软件监控主要包括以下几个方面:
流量监控:实时监测网络流量,分析数据包,识别异常流量。
系统监控:监控操作系统、数据库、应用程序等系统组件的状态,确保系统稳定运行。
用户行为监控:分析用户操作行为,识别异常行为,防范恶意攻击。
日志分析:对系统日志进行分析,发现潜在的安全风险。
二、网络攻击类型及识别方法
- 恶意代码攻击:通过植入恶意代码,窃取用户信息、破坏系统功能等。
识别方法:利用杀毒软件、入侵检测系统等工具,对恶意代码进行检测和清除。
- 钓鱼攻击:通过伪造官方网站、发送钓鱼邮件等方式,诱骗用户输入个人信息。
识别方法:加强用户安全意识,对可疑邮件、网站进行识别,避免上当受骗。
- DDoS攻击:通过大量恶意流量攻击目标网站,使其无法正常运行。
识别方法:采用流量清洗、带宽扩展等技术手段,抵御DDoS攻击。
- SQL注入攻击:通过在数据库查询语句中插入恶意代码,获取数据库敏感信息。
识别方法:加强数据库安全防护,对输入数据进行过滤和验证,防止SQL注入攻击。
- 中间人攻击:攻击者窃取用户与服务器之间的通信数据,获取用户信息。
识别方法:采用HTTPS、VPN等技术手段,保障通信安全。
三、网络软件监控识别网络攻击的关键技术
机器学习:通过分析大量历史数据,训练模型,自动识别异常行为。
数据挖掘:从海量数据中挖掘潜在的安全风险,为安全防护提供依据。
行为分析:分析用户行为,识别异常操作,防范恶意攻击。
入侵检测:实时监测网络流量,发现潜在攻击行为。
四、案例分析
案例一:某企业通过部署网络软件监控,成功识别并阻止了一次针对企业数据库的SQL注入攻击。该攻击企图通过恶意代码获取企业客户信息,企业及时采取措施,避免了损失。
案例二:某电商平台通过流量监控,发现大量异常流量涌入,疑似DDoS攻击。企业迅速采取流量清洗、带宽扩展等措施,成功抵御了攻击。
五、总结
网络软件监控在识别网络攻击方面发挥着重要作用。通过实时监测、数据分析、行为分析等技术手段,网络软件监控可以有效防范各种网络攻击,保障网络安全。企业、组织和个人应重视网络安全,加强网络软件监控,共同维护网络空间安全。
猜你喜欢:云原生可观测性